Next Service

  • “The Earth Belongs to the Living” with Professor Beau Breslin
    June 29, 2025

    As we approach Independence Day, Skidmore College political science professor and constitutional scholar Beau Breslin will lead a compelling service focused on the power of our Constitution and the importance of renewing it.     UU Saratoga is a proudly Unitarian Universalist Congregation

    Unitarian Universalism draws from heritages of freedom, reason, hope, and courage, building on the foundation of love. Love is the power that holds us together and is at the center of our shared values: Interdependence, Pluralism, Justice, Transformation, Generosity, and Equity. Read More
